Talking Week 14 – June 24th – Owner Mid-Season Review and Team Stats Update

I got my mid-season review from John Sherman today as we start our home series against Miami, then a 4-game series against Cleveland to end the month. It would be great to get retribution against Cleveland here at home to end our June on a good note, but that's YTBD. In the meantime, my reaction to John’s performance of my review so far.

Name:  owner_goals.jpg
Views: 8
Size:  86.8 KB

Todd "BigP",
I have reviewed the goals I have set for you. My comments are below.

Team Record:
I'm disappointed in the team's performance this year. Worse, our fans are as well. Let's work on getting the team motivated to go out and win.


We have lacked offensive production pretty much all season. What I’ve done with the team this year has been my best effort as manager. I can think of a couple of games where I will take responsibility for our loss, but otherwise, I’m disappointed in the effort I’m getting from a few of the players. They will need to turn things around here soon with the trade deadline coming up, and after that, I’ll be ready to purge a few roster spots. Our Pythagorean says we’re right where we should be with games, but it’s the RDiff that’s killing us at -53. We’re currently 10 ½ games back from the division leader, the Minnesota Twins, with a 4-game series coming later this week against our divisional rivals Cleveland where we can gain some ground with solid offensive production. I hope we can do that.

Upgrade a position:
I don't see any improvement from where we were last year at Left Field. Please be on the lookout for an upgrade if you want to keep me happy.


Javier Vaz’s offensive production was damn fine up til he got injured, and we’ve had to treat him with TLC for the next few days, but I think he can be the LF improvement John’s looking for. We also have MJ Melendez, who has played the position well. He happens to be in a bit of a slump, though. So, I’m not too worried about this one right now since it’s not a high priority for John, but I’ll continue to give players an opportunity there and see who wants it.

Find a top prospect:
I'm not convinced Javier Vaz has a future with our club. He's certainly not a bad prospect, but I think you can do a better job at finding a top prospect.


As I said for the previous goal, Vaz is the best we've got right now, and I think he’s developing into a fine utility player with great lead-off potential. I’m not going to move off of him just yet.

Build your farm:
I have to say, I'm not too thrilled about our current prospect pool. I know I have given you some time to complete this task, but it looks like you need to put in a little bit more effort to improve our pool.

The personnel I replaced and hired in the preseason were my initial effort towards this, but I’m not done with that yet. My biggest concern this off-season will be the 2025/26 expiring contracts of our Double and Triple A club’s aging managers and coaches. I’ll have 5 coaches reaching 60+ years old, with Omaha's Mike Jirschele very near retirement at 65 now. I may want to offer him an early retirement, along with a couple of other guys, and look on the personnel wire for some younger coaching staff in our full-season minor league clubs.

Our Rookie ball clubs seem to be doing well now, so I don’t think I have much to worry about there. There could be a couple of coaches who get promoted to the higher minor clubs, too. That will be for consideration come this off-season.

Improve your fan interest:
Plan A to increase fan interest has had minimal impact. I hope you have a Plan B.


I wish I had a Plan B, John. At least I haven’t gotten rid of Salvy or Vinnie, which would have put us in the dumpster fire even deeper. These KC fans are fickle.

During our time working together, I have been ecstatic with your progress towards the goals I have set for you. That being said, when I look at the team's history on and off the field, my overall impression doesn't rank quite as high.

The final evaluation towards these goals will come at the end of the season. Good luck in the second half!

John Sherman


Ok John, message received. I’ll try to do better.

There are A LOT of areas we need to improve to meet a close to .500 season goal. How we get there is still TBD, but the bottom line is our offensive production needs to drastically improve our OBP and slugging percentage and turn some of those hits into runs. I think that improves with another power hitter in our lineup and getting Salvy out of his slump. Let's see where we are as we go into July and the All-Star break. That's my near-term target for more major decisions as needed.

There’s still work to be done, so that’s enough moping on my sub-par performance. I’m looking forward to the next review I have with John, come October. That should be fun.
